Forged in Fire: The Making of a Maverick
Elon Musk's origin story reads like a superhero's tragic beginning. Born in Pretoria, South Africa in 1971, he inherited adventurous genes from his maternal grandparents, Joshua and Winnifred Haldeman-known as "The Flying Haldemans" after Joshua impulsively traded his car for a plane despite not knowing how to fly. His father Errol, an engineer with a wheeler-dealer spirit, embodied both brilliance and darkness. Errol's emotional abuse would leave permanent scars on Elon's psyche, creating cyclical moods that swung between light and dark, with occasional plunges into what others called "demon mode."
From infancy, Elon was exceptional-crying constantly, eating voraciously, and rarely sleeping. His intellectual curiosity was matched by an inability to connect with peers. One teacher believed he might be "retarded" because he frequently "zoned out," staring out windows and seeming unresponsive. "Ever since I was a kid, if I start to think about something hard, then all of my sensory systems turn off," Elon explains. "I'm using my brain to compute, not for incoming information."
His parents' divorce when he was eight compounded his isolation. After initially living with his mother Maye, who struggled financially as a model and dietician, ten-year-old Elon made a fateful decision he would later regret: moving in with his father. "My dad was lonely, so lonely, and I felt I should keep him company. He used psychological wiles on me," he recalls. Four years later, Kimbal followed: "I didn't want to leave my brother alone with him."
Living with Errol exposed the boys to both opportunity and danger. Errol's home contained two encyclopedias and engineering tools that fascinated Elon, but also subjected them to his Jekyll-and-Hyde personality-jovial one moment, vicious and abusive the next. "His mood could change on a dime," Tosca recalls. "Everything could be super, then within a second he would be vicious and spewing abuse."
This unpredictable environment taught Elon to question reality itself. Errol's tendency to distort facts, present false information, and weave self-aggrandizing tales created a confusing world. "Can you imagine growing up like that?" Kimbal asks. "It was mental torture, and it infects you. You end up asking, 'What is reality?'"
Yet amid this chaos, young Elon found refuge in books, science fiction, and computers. He devoured encyclopedias, taught himself programming, and created his first video game, "Blastar," at thirteen. Douglas Adams's "The Hitchhiker's Guide to the Galaxy" helped him overcome existential depression with its subtle humor, while Isaac Asimov's robot stories introduced him to questions about artificial intelligence that would later obsess him. These early readings connected directly to his future missions-he would later tweet that "Foundation Series & Zeroth Law are fundamental to creation of SpaceX."

Escape Velocity: Breaking Free from South Africa
By seventeen, Elon recognized he needed to escape both his father's increasingly erratic behavior and South Africa's violence and limited opportunities. Taking initiative, he obtained Canadian passport applications for himself, his mother, brother, and sister-deliberately excluding his father. On June 11, 1989, just before his eighteenth birthday, he boarded a flight to Montreal with just $4,000-half from his father and half from his mother's old stock account.
Contrary to myths about arriving in North America with wealth from his father's emerald mine, Elon landed in Canada nearly penniless. He stayed in youth hostels, initially sleeping on his backpack out of South African caution until "I realized that not everyone was a murderer." After a week, he purchased a $100 Greyhound Discovery Pass and headed to Saskatchewan to stay with a distant cousin, working on wheat farms and construction sites.
The family eventually reunited in Toronto, where they crammed into a one-bedroom apartment with such limited funds that Maye cried over spilled milk they couldn't afford to replace. All worked multiple jobs-Tosca at a hamburger joint, Elon as a Microsoft intern, and Maye juggling university work, modeling, and diet consulting.
At Queen's University in Kingston, Ontario, Elon found his first real friend outside family-Navaid Farooq, a fellow international student who shared his interests in computer games, obscure history, and science fiction. Their late-night philosophical discussions about life's meaning provided the intellectual stimulation Elon craved. When Kimbal joined Elon at Queen's, the brothers developed a habit of cold-calling interesting people from newspapers, leading to an internship with Scotiabank's strategic planning executive Peter Nicholson.
This banking experience gave Musk "a healthy disrespect for the financial industry" that would later fuel PayPal's creation. More importantly, it confirmed his unsuitability for working under others-he struggled with deference and couldn't accept that others might know more than he did.
After transferring to the University of Pennsylvania in 1992, Musk pursued a joint degree in physics and business, explaining: "I was concerned that if I didn't study business, I would be forced to work for someone who did." Despite his social awkwardness, he found his tribe among science-minded geeks and even organized massive parties with his roommate Adeo Ressi. Though Musk enjoyed the atmosphere, he remained somewhat detached-staying sober to manage things while others got "wasted." As Ressi noted, "He enjoyed being around a party but not fully in it... I wish Elon knew how to be a little happier."

Silicon Valley Disruptor: Zip2, PayPal, and Early Ventures
After a summer internship in Silicon Valley researching supercapacitors and programming video games, Musk recognized the internet revolution was beginning. He had identified three areas that would "truly affect humanity: the internet, sustainable energy, and space travel." When Netscape's explosive IPO signaled the internet's potential in August 1995, Musk deferred his Stanford enrollment to "catch the internet wave."
With his brother Kimbal, Musk launched Zip2, combining business directories with interactive maps-a concept some traditional publishers dismissed. Operating from a tiny Palo Alto office where they initially slept on futons and showered at the YMCA, they subsisted on Jack in the Box meals and support from their parents. Their breakthrough came when Navteq offered free map database licensing until they became profitable. To impress potential investors, they placed a small computer in a large rack they called "The Machine That Goes Ping." Their persistence paid off when Mohr Davidow Ventures invested $3 million in 1996.
From his earliest days as a founder, Musk established himself as a relentlessly demanding manager with no tolerance for work-life balance. At Zip2, he worked through days and nights without vacations, expecting his team to match his intensity. After other engineers left for the day, Musk would often rewrite their code, publicly criticizing what he called their "fucking stupid code" without concern for hurt feelings. His relationship with Kimbal was particularly volatile, resulting in physical office fights that sometimes ended with the brothers wrestling on the floor.
In January 1999, Compaq Computer acquired Zip2 for $307 million cash, transforming Elon's bank account "from like $5,000 to $22,005,000" at age twenty-seven. Shortly after selling Zip2, Musk founded X.com with Harris Fricker, investing $12 million of his Zip2 proceeds. His revolutionary insight was that money is fundamentally just a database entry, and by creating a system where transactions could be recorded securely in real time with no clearing delays, he could build a platform that would keep money within its ecosystem.
As X.com and Confinity's PayPal competed fiercely for customers in early 2000, Musk and Peter Thiel recognized that only one would survive due to network effects. Despite Musk initially proposing outlandish merger terms (90% ownership), they eventually agreed to a near 50-50 merger with X.com as the surviving entity. After the merger, a fundamental strategic divide emerged-Musk insisted on pursuing his grander vision of X.com as a financial social network, while others wanted to focus on PayPal's success on eBay.
What distinguished Musk at PayPal was his appetite for risk. Unlike most entrepreneurs who try to mitigate risk, Musk amplified it. "He was into amplifying risk and burning the boats so we could never retreat from it," observed Roelof Botha. This made him fundamentally different from Thiel, who focused on limiting risks. In September 2000, tensions reached a breaking point when Thiel and other executives orchestrated a coup while Musk was on his honeymoon in Australia. Though Musk fought to retain control, he ultimately accepted his removal with surprising grace, telling employees he'd decided "the time has come to bring in a seasoned CEO."

Rocket Man: The Birth of SpaceX
After his ouster from PayPal, Musk began exploring new frontiers-both literally and figuratively. He bought a single-engine turboprop and earned his pilot's license, later upgrading to a Soviet-built military jet for acrobatic flying. These experiences fed both his daredevil nature and his understanding of aerodynamics.
During Labor Day weekend of 2001, while driving back to Manhattan with his friend Adeo Ressi, Musk mused about his interest in space. Initially dismissing it as too expensive for an individual, they calculated by the Midtown Tunnel that it might actually be possible with just metal and fuel. That evening, Musk was shocked to discover NASA had no concrete plans for Mars missions. His Google searches led him to a Mars Society dinner where he met Robert Zubrin and filmmaker James Cameron.
The thirty-year-old entrepreneur, freshly ousted from two tech startups, had made an astonishing pivot to building Mars-bound rockets. Beyond his aversion to vacations and childhood love of rockets, sci-fi, and "A Hitchhiker's Guide to the Galaxy," Musk began explaining to bemused friends his three reasons for this seemingly wild venture: First, technological progress isn't inevitable-it could stop or backslide like ancient Egypt or Rome. Second, colonizing other planets would ensure human survival if Earth faced catastrophe. Third, pursuing Mars would rekindle America's pioneer spirit. "Life cannot be merely about solving problems," he believed. "It also had to be about pursuing great dreams."
Musk relocated to Los Angeles to access aerospace engineering talent and began gathering rocket engineers for meetings. Through the Mars Society, he connected with Jim Cantrell, who had worked on U.S.-Russian missile decommissioning programs. Together they planned a trip to Russia to explore buying launch slots or rockets. When negotiations for Russian rockets collapsed after prices kept escalating, Musk's frustration led him to apply first-principles thinking, calculating what he called an "idiot index"-how much more a finished product costs than its basic materials. Finding rockets had an extremely high idiot index, he began spreadsheet calculations on the flight home, shocking his companions by concluding, "I think we can build this rocket ourselves."
In May 2002, he incorporated Space Exploration Technologies (later SpaceX), aiming to launch by September 2003 and reach Mars by 2010-continuing his tradition of wildly optimistic timelines. His strategy focused on smaller, less expensive rockets for launching microsatellites, with the key metric being cost-per-pound to orbit.

Manufacturing Revolution: Tesla's Disruptive Journey
The origins of Tesla Motors emerged from the convergence of several innovators passionate about electric vehicles. JB Straubel, who had converted an old Porsche to electric power using lead-acid batteries, became obsessed with using lithium-ion batteries for electric vehicles. When he met Musk at a Stanford seminar in October 2003, Straubel pitched his electric vehicle idea, and Musk immediately committed $10,000 in funding.
Meanwhile, Martin Eberhard, a Silicon Valley entrepreneur who had created the Rocket eBook, had been methodically calculating the energy efficiency of different vehicles and discovered electric cars were best for the environment. After seeing AC Propulsion's tzero prototype, he enlisted his friend Marc Tarpenning to start Tesla Motors in July 2003.
When AC Propulsion's Tom Gage couldn't convince Musk to invest, he connected Musk with Eberhard. Their initial meeting stretched from thirty minutes to two hours as they shared visions for a supercharged electric car. Musk agreed to lead the initial financing with $6.4 million and become board chair. He insisted that Eberhard connect with Straubel, bringing together all the key players.
Despite Musk's eventual insistence on vertical integration-making key components in-house rather than relying on suppliers-Tesla initially took the opposite approach. Eberhard and Tarpenning decided to cobble together their first car from outsourced components, following the industry trend away from in-house production. They arranged for Lotus to supply modified Elise roadster bodies and AC Propulsion to provide electric engines and powertrains.
As Musk became more involved with Tesla, he couldn't resist making significant design changes to the Roadster. Against Eberhard's resistance, he insisted on enlarging the door opening by three inches (adding $2 million in costs), widening the seats, redesigning the headlights (another $500,000), and using carbon fiber instead of fiberglass for the body. He demanded electric touch door handles rather than standard latches and obsessed over aesthetic details, insisting "we only get to release our first car once." While these changes made the car more beautiful and distinctive, they burned through cash and complicated the supply chain.
Both Eberhard and Musk considered themselves the main founder of Tesla, creating an inherently unstable leadership dynamic. Eberhard believed he was the founder since he conceived the idea, registered the company, chose the name, and found funders. Musk countered that he connected Eberhard with Straubel and provided the essential funding to start the company when they had "no intellectual property, no employees, nothing." This tension would eventually lead to Eberhard's ouster in 2007 when Musk discovered the Roadster's target cost had ballooned from $50,000 to over $110,000 per car.

Trial by Fire: SpaceX's Path to Orbit
SpaceX's move to the remote Kwajalein Atoll (Kwaj) in the Marshall Islands came after frustrating delays at Vandenberg Air Force Base, where bureaucratic rules clashed with Musk's question-everything culture. The scrappy team developed creative money-saving solutions and overcame incredible logistical challenges, like when engineer Bulent Altan traveled around the world in 40 sleepless hours to fix faulty capacitors before their launch window closed.
On March 24, 2006, the day of SpaceX's first launch attempt, Elon and Kimbal Musk began with a stress-relieving bike ride at sunrise before Elon headed to the control center. As the countdown approached, Musk characteristically retreated into future planning, interrogating his bewildered launch conductor about materials for the not-yet-built Falcon 5 rocket. Only when the Falcon 1 lifted off did Musk focus on the present moment, but the celebration was brief. Twenty-five seconds into flight, engineers spotted a fire and loss of thrust. The rocket fell back toward Earth, crashing into the ocean.
After the first launch failure, SpaceX became methodical, testing and documenting each rocket component while balancing caution with Musk's calculated risk-taking. In March 2007, the second launch initially appeared successful, with the rocket reaching space. For five celebratory minutes, champagne flowed at SpaceX headquarters-until they noticed the second stage wobbling on video. The fuel sloshing had caused the rocket to spin out of control, and the payload crashed back to Earth from 180 miles up.
The third launch attempt in August 2008 carried high stakes-a valuable Air Force satellite, two NASA satellites, and even the cremated remains of James Doohan (Star Trek's "Scotty"). With Musk believing this was their final chance ("if we couldn't do it in three, we deserved to die"), the initial liftoff went perfectly. But triumph turned to horror when, one second after separation, the booster spurted upward and collided with the second stage.
Despite this third consecutive failure-amid his divorce and Tesla's financial crisis-Musk refused to surrender. "SpaceX will not skip a beat," he announced hours later. "There should be absolutely zero question that SpaceX will prevail in reaching orbit. I will never give up, and I mean never." The next day, rather than seeking scapegoats, Musk stunned his team by ordering them to build a fourth rocket from components in the factory and launch within six weeks.
On September 28, 2008, SpaceX's fourth launch represented the company's last chance-failure would mean the end of both SpaceX and likely Tesla. When the rocket successfully reached orbit, Musk finally let out a whoop of joy. The Falcon 1 had made history as the first privately built rocket to reach orbit from the ground, designed and constructed almost entirely in-house by just 500 employees. As author Ashlee Vance wrote, "Like Roger Bannister besting the four-minute mile, SpaceX made people recalibrate their sense of limitation when it came to getting to space."

Crisis and Triumph: Tesla's Manufacturing Hell
In February 2008, Tesla celebrated the delivery of its first production Roadster, codenamed "P1," with Musk taking a victory lap around Palo Alto. But this milestone masked severe challenges-the global economy was sliding into recession, Tesla's supply chain was unwieldy, and the company was rapidly running out of money, all while SpaceX had yet to achieve orbit. "Even though I now had a Roadster," Musk recalls, "it was the beginning of the most painful year of my life."
By fall 2008, he was desperately seeking funds from friends and family to meet payroll. Kimbal sold his last $375,000 in Apple stock despite warnings from his banker. Google's Sergey Brin invested $500,000, eBay's first president Jeff Skoll provided personal loans, and even Tesla employees contributed. The stress manifested physically-his partner Talulah witnessed night terrors, vomiting episodes, and dramatic weight fluctuations. "I was working every day, all day and night, in a situation that required me to pull a rabbit out of the hat, now do it again, now do it again," Musk says.
Despite persistent criticism that Tesla was "bailed out" or "subsidized" by the government in 2009, the company never received money from the Treasury Department's Troubled Asset Relief Program that provided $18.4 billion to General Motors and Chrysler during their bankruptcy restructurings. What Tesla did receive was $465 million in interest-bearing loans from the Department of Energy's Advanced Technology Vehicles Manufacturing Loan Program in June 2009, which they repaid with $12 million interest three years later.
A more crucial lifeline came from Daimler. After flying to Stuttgart in October 2008, Musk's team scrambled to create an electric Smart car prototype by retrofitting one with a Roadster motor and battery pack. When grumpy Daimler executives visited in January 2009, they were blown away by the high-performance prototype that "hauled ass" and could "do wheelies." This led to a contract for Tesla to provide battery packs and powertrains for Smart cars, and crucially, a $50 million equity investment from Daimler in May 2009. "If Daimler had not invested in Tesla at that time we would have died," Musk admits.
The Christmas 2008 financing, Daimler investment, and government loan allowed Musk to proceed with the Model S-a mainstream four-door sedan priced around $60,000 that would transform Tesla into a real automotive company. Franz von Holzhausen, a Euro-cool designer from Connecticut with experience at Volkswagen, GM and Mazda, joined Tesla during the brutal summer of 2008. After seeing Fisker's Model S designs at the Santa Monica showroom opening, von Holzhausen boldly declared, "That is really no good. I can make you something great." Musk hired him on the spot, beginning what would become one of his few calm, nondramatic professional relationships.

The Future Factory: Revolutionizing Manufacturing
While American companies were aggressively offshoring manufacturing in the early 2000s-the U.S. lost one-third of its manufacturing jobs between 2000 and 2010-Musk bucked this trend with Tesla. He believed controlling the manufacturing process was crucial and that designing "the machine that builds the machine" was as important as designing the car itself. This design-manufacturing feedback loop gave Tesla a competitive advantage. Unlike Steve Jobs who outsourced manufacturing, Musk spent more time walking assembly lines than design studios, applying his obsessive focus to the factory floor.
In May 2010, Musk acquired Toyota's mothballed Fremont factory for just $42 million (originally worth $1 billion), with Toyota also investing $50 million in Tesla. He redesigned the factory placing engineers' cubicles right beside assembly lines so they would immediately see and hear whenever their designs caused problems. A month later, Tesla went public-the first American carmaker IPO since Ford's in 1956-raising $266 million. At the celebration, Musk made a characteristically pithy toast: "Fuck oil."
When the first Model S cars rolled off the Fremont assembly line in June 2012, hundreds celebrated, including California governor Jerry Brown. But when Musk received his own Model S, he declared it "sucked," criticizing panel gaps and paint quality. He fired three production quality chiefs in succession and assigned his chief designer Franz von Holzhausen to move to Fremont for a year to fix quality issues. The validation came when Motor Trend named the Model S its 2012 Car of the Year, the first electric vehicle to win, praising it as "proof positive that America can still make (great) things."
In 2013, Musk proposed building a battery factory with output greater than all other battery factories in the world combined-what JB Straubel called a "science fiction crazy" idea. Despite having "no clue how to build a battery factory," Musk and Straubel pursued a partnership with Panasonic, where Panasonic would make cells and Tesla would assemble battery packs in a 10-million-square-foot, $5 billion facility. When Panasonic hesitated, Musk staged a charade-setting up lights and bulldozers at a Nevada site and inviting Panasonic executives to watch, signaling Tesla would proceed with or without them. The gambit worked, leading to a meeting in Japan where Musk convinced Panasonic's president Kazuhiro Tsuga to become a 40% partner.
The summer of 2017 through fall of 2018 became what Musk calls "the time of most concentrated pain I've ever had-eighteen months of unrelenting insanity." When the Model 3 began production in July 2017, Musk warned about tough times ahead: "Frankly we're going to be in production hell," he said, giggling maniacally. "Welcome! Welcome! Welcome to production hell! That's where we are going to be for at least six months."
From the production hell experiences at Nevada and Fremont emerged what Musk calls "the algorithm"-five commandments he would repeat "to an annoying degree" at production meetings: 1) Question every requirement and who made it; 2) Delete any unnecessary part or process; 3) Simplify and optimize only after deletion; 4) Accelerate cycle time; 5) Automate last, not first.

The Twitter Saga: Buying the Digital Town Square
In April 2022, Musk was at a pinnacle of success. Tesla sales had grown 71% in the previous year without any advertising, with stock value fifteen times higher than five years prior-worth more than the next nine auto companies combined. SpaceX had launched twice as much mass into orbit as all other companies and countries combined in the first quarter. His companies were valued at staggering amounts: Tesla at $1 trillion, SpaceX at $100 billion, The Boring Company at $5.6 billion, and Neuralink at $1 billion.
Yet despite this unprecedented success, Musk was restless. As Shivon Zilis observed, "It was like he was winning the simulation and now felt at a loss for what to do." Musk acknowledged this trait: "I guess I've always wanted to push my chips back on the table or play the next level of the game. I'm not good at sitting back." Rather than manufacturing a crisis within one of his companies as he typically did during periods of calm, Musk made an impulsive decision that would create an entirely new drama: buying Twitter.
Twitter was the perfect playground for Musk-rewarding impulsivity, irreverence, and unfiltered commentary. He had first used Twitter in 2006 but abandoned it, finding tweets about "what kind of latte somebody had at Starbucks" boring. His friend Bill Lee convinced him to return in 2011 for unfiltered public communication. By 2022, Musk had grown increasingly concerned with what he called the "woke-mind virus" and Twitter's content moderation policies. Though he disdained Trump, he believed permanently banning a former president was absurd.
In January 2022, Musk began secretly buying Twitter shares. After accepting and then rejecting a board seat, he shocked the business world on April 14 by offering to buy Twitter outright for $54.20 per share-a $44 billion valuation. His rationale went beyond business strategy. He believed it could be part of his mission of "preserving civilization" by ensuring free speech and purging what he saw as Twitter's woke culture. For democracy to survive, he felt it was crucial to create an open space for all opinions. But there were also more personal motivations: Twitter was fun, like an amusement park of political smackdowns and intellectual gladiator matches. And psychologically, it represented the ultimate playground-a place where, unlike his painful childhood experiences of being bullied, he could now own the terrain and control the rules.
By June 2022, Musk was wavering on the Twitter acquisition. He brought in Bob Swan to model financial options, but when Swan presented a somewhat positive assessment, Musk challenged him angrily. When Twitter resisted providing usable data about fake accounts, Musk attempted to withdraw from the merger. Twitter sued him in Delaware's chancery court, with a trial set for October. By late September, his lawyers convinced him he would lose in court, and Musk agreed to the original terms of $54.20 per share.
On October 27, 2022, Musk completed the Twitter purchase with a dramatic flourish-entering headquarters carrying a sink ("let that sink in!"). He immediately fired CEO Parag Agrawal, CFO Ned Segal, legal head Vijaya Gadde, and general counsel Sean Edgett. The timing was deliberate-Agrawal had his resignation letter ready but couldn't send it through his now-disabled Twitter email.
The collision was between two radically different workplace philosophies: Twitter prided itself on being a high-empathy environment where "psychological safety" was paramount, with permanent work-from-home options and monthly mental "days of rest." Musk, who laughed bitterly at the concept of "psychological safety," preferred "hardcore" urgency and considered discomfort a weapon against complacency. Within weeks, he had slashed Twitter's workforce from 8,000 to just over 2,000-a 75% reduction representing a complete cultural transformation from one of tech's most nurturing workplaces to an environment of "psychological danger."

Multiplanetary Dreams: The Starship Vision
Despite SpaceX's success with the Falcon 9, Musk remained focused on his ultimate goal: getting humanity to Mars. In September 2017, he announced the development of BFR (later renamed Starship), the tallest and most powerful rocket ever built. At 390 feet high-50% taller than Falcon 9 and exceeding the Saturn V-Starship would carry over 100 tons to orbit with its thirty-three engines, four times Falcon 9's capacity.
In late 2018, Musk and engineer Bill Riley discovered that carbon fiber was causing production problems for Starship. "If we keep going with carbon fiber, we're doomed," Musk declared. Drawing inspiration from early Atlas rockets and his Cybertruck design, Musk proposed switching to stainless steel despite initial resistance from his team. When they "ran the numbers," they found steel could actually be lighter in the conditions Starship would face: its strength increases 50% at cold temperatures, its high melting point eliminated the need for heat shields on one side, and it could be welded together simply-even outdoors.
In 2018, Musk transformed SpaceX's dormant Boca Chica, Texas site into the dedicated manufacturing facility for Starship. When progress seemed slow, Musk would issue seemingly impossible challenges-like "build a dome by dawn"-and stay up with teams until completion. He purchased most homes in a nearby tract development and chose a humble two-bedroom house for himself, with white walls, wooden floors, and posters of sci-fi magazine covers.
"My stomach is twisted in knots," Musk confessed to Mark Juncosa before the experimental Starship launch in April 2023. "It always happens before a big launch. I have PTSD from the failures on Kwaj." After an aborted first countdown, the launch was rescheduled for April 20-a date that amused Musk as "fated" (referencing the 420 meme). On launch day, Musk arrived at 4:30 a.m. after just three hours of sleep. Despite sensor issues, he deemed the risk acceptable. At ignition, the rocket's thirty-three Raptors fired, lifting slowly. "Holy shit, it's going up!" Musk shouted, running outside to witness the ascent. But the rocket began wobbling-four engines had failed-and protocols required detonating it over water three minutes into flight.
The Starship explosion perfectly symbolized Musk himself-his compulsion to aim high, take wild risks, accomplish amazing things, yet leave smoldering debris in his wake. His friends urged him to restrain his impetuous instincts, recalling how Antonio Gracias once locked Musk's phone in a hotel safe overnight (Musk summoned security at 3 a.m. to retrieve it). "I've shot myself in the foot so often I ought to buy some Kevlar boots," Musk joked. Yet the question remains whether a restrained Musk could accomplish as much as Musk unbound-whether being untethered is integral to his success, despite the collateral damage.
